Comfortable Seating

If you are going to be using an electric scooter for extended periods of time then comfort is paramount. There are many scooters with different seating options that can be adjusted to suit all tastes and body types. A swivel chair is one option that gives the rider an easy transition to and from the scooter. It can also be adjusted for maximum comfort. Another option is an elevating seat that increases the height of the passenger and driver to facilitate entry and exit.

You can pick an electric scooter with seats that fold up. This lets the second person put it away when not in use. This kind of seating is used on smaller mobility scooters that have two seats. It is similar to what you find on gasoline-powered mopeds and bikes.

Bariatric scooters are made to accommodate those with a larger build and are usually equipped with a larger seating area for maximum comfort. A wide variety of accessories is available to make driving as enjoyable and comfortable as is possible. These can include a range of headrest and arm rest adjustments as well as a front basket to carry shopping and other things, and even rear pouches.

Easy to operate

Many models have comfortable, cushioned captain's chairs and flip-up armrests, making them easy to drive. Certain models have swivel design, which make it easy to transfer from the scooter to your car. You should consider your driving needs and how you plan to use the scooter around home before you decide on the right model. If you'll need to transport the scooter to and from the car, choose models that have parts that can be broken down into manageable parts. The rear wheels of the scooter are typically the largest part, and can weigh between 30-45 pounds. You should mobility scooters be on the pavement know the weight of the largest part of the scooter prior buying it. This will help you ensure that you are able to handle the weight of the entire unit during disassembly.

If you're planning to take your scooter on public roads it is essential to choose a model with a turning radius and ground clearance that can accommodate your mobility needs. The turning radius is the smallest circular rotation the scooter can make and determines the degree of maneuverability it can achieve in tight spaces. Choosing a model with more streamlined turning radius will allow you to navigate easily through indoor spaces like shopping malls, while having a wider wheelbase and bigger tires are more suitable for outdoor terrain.

The ground clearance of mobility scooters is the distance between the tire's base and the undercarriage. It determines how stable the scooter is on uneven surfaces. Choose models with greater ground clearance to ensure that your scooter can ride over bumps, obstacles, and other obstacles.

Check the product specifications to see if your scooter, especially one that's all-terrain, comes with hill climbing capabilities. This feature is especially useful when you have steep hills to climb.

It is essential to select the right scooter that will comfortably support your weight. A scooter that's not designed to support the weight of your body may be more prone to wear out and decrease the battery's efficiency.
